WebReturn of Remains of Deceased U.S. Citizens. When a U.S. citizen dies abroad, U.S. consular officers assist families in making arrangements with local authorities for preparation and disposition of the remains. Options available to a family depend upon local law and practice in the foreign country. U.S. and foreign law require the following ... Attend Your Appointment and Apply for Italian Passport WebApr 6, 2015 · Now You Can Get a British Passport even if Your British Father wasn’t Married at the time of your Birth. As of April 6, 2015, if you do not have British citizenship but your father was a British citizen, your parents never married, and you were born before July 1, 2006, you will now have the possibility of acquiring British citizenship.

Passport applications can be an excellent source of genealogical information, especially about foreign-born individuals. The National Archives and Records Administration (NARA) has passport applications from October 1795-March 1925; the U.S. Department of State has passport applications from April 1925 to the … thinkpad x1 无法开机 bitlockerWebFor example, a passport will be cancelled if there is an urgency to act to protect the best interests of a child or if communication with the bearer is not possible (e.g. the bearer is deceased).
